%description
GUAVA is a package that implements coding theory algorithms in GAP.
With GUAVA, codes can be created and manipulated and information
about codes can be calculated.

GUAVA consists of various files written in the GAP language, and an
external program for dealing with automorphism groups of codes and
isomorphism testing functions. Several algorithms that need the speed
are integrated in the GAP kernel.
